15 Recipes to Jazz Up Your Summer Salad

Salad

Summer salads are a refreshing way to showcase seasonal produce and add variety to warm-weather meals. With peak season fruits and veggies, salads go from boring diet food to delicious anytime dishes. According to a 2022 survey, an average American enjoys four salads every week, with a whopping 62% saying this dish is a regular part of their diet.

The survey also revealed some preferences for the perfect salad. Most respondents (78%) prefer chopped salad, 60% enjoy it tossed with dressing, and 58% opt for it as a side dish. Interestingly, 51% said they like their salad “loaded” with all sorts of toppings. This includes favorites like fruit, which was preferred by 57%, and roasted vegetables, chosen by 52%. Given this wide range of preferences, the room for experimentation when it comes to crafting summer salads is virtually limitless.

You can easily jazz up a summer salad by mixing fruits, nuts, and proteins or swapping out lettuce for grains. Those who relish variety in their salads will love these inventive approaches. Here is a list of 15 exciting salad ideas that will ensure no taste bud is ever left feeling bored.

1. Watermelon Feta Salad

Watermelon and feta cheese are a match made in salad heaven. The sweet juiciness of watermelon pairs perfectly with the briny, salty feta. This combo makes a great summer salad for backyard BBQs or picnics. Toss cubed watermelon, crumbled feta, fresh mint, and red onion with balsamic vinaigrette. The tangy sweet dressing brings all the flavors together.

2. Layered salad

This super easy 7 layer salad is a potluck staple for a reason – it’s loaded with flavor and color and is so easy to make. Simply layer ingredients in a glass dish: lettuce, tomatoes, cucumbers, onions, cheese, bacon, and chickpeas. Top with your favorite dressing and refrigerate until chilled. The veggies soak up the dressing as it chills, yielding maximum flavor. Mix it all together before serving this fresh and crunchy salad.

3. Mango Avocado Salad with Shrimp

Take your salad to the tropics with fresh mango, avocado, and shrimp. Dice mango and avocado and mix with cooked shrimp, red onion, cilantro, and lime juice. The sweet mango and creamy avocado pair perfectly with tender shrimp. Garnish with toasted coconut for some crunch. This salad transports you to the islands in one bite.

4. Caprese Farro Salad

For a fresh take on this classic Italian salad, use farro instead of lettuce. Cooked farro tossed with juicy tomatoes, creamy mozzarella, basil, olive oil, and balsamic vinegar makes a satisfying summer meal. Farro adds a hearty nuttiness that pairs perfectly with the bright tomatoes and cheese.

5. Greek Salad Lettuce Wraps

Ditch the bowl and serve this flavorful salad in lettuce wraps. Fill leaves of romaine or butter lettuce with diced cucumber, tomato, red onion, olives, feta, and Greek dressing. The fresh lettuce cups add a fun, interactive element to this traditional Greek salad. Kids will love assembling their own wraps.

6. Cobb Salad Mason Jar

Pack your next picnic or work lunch in a mason jar Cobb salad. Layer chopped romaine, chicken, bacon, egg, tomato, avocado, blue cheese, and dressing in a jar. When ready to eat, shake the jar to mix everything. You get the classic Cobb flavors in a convenient, portable package.

7. BLT Pasta Salad

For a fun twist on a classic sandwich, turn it into a pasta salad. Toss penne or rotini with crispy bacon pieces, halved cherry tomatoes, shredded romaine, and creamy ranch dressing. Top with shredded cheddar or parmesan for extra richness. This hearty salad is perfect for potlucks or as a side at your next cookout.

8. Grilled Romaine Caesar Salad

Grilled lettuce adds a smoky depth to this classic salad. Halve heads of romaine and drizzle with olive oil. Grill over medium heat until lightly charred. Top with croutons, parmesan, and creamy Caesar dressing. The charred lettuce gives a wonderfully smoky flavor to this summery twist on Caesar salad.

9. Curried Chicken Salad with Grapes

Jazz up a chicken salad with the addition of curry powder and seedless grapes. Mix shredded chicken, halved grapes, celery, curry powder, lemon juice, and mayo. The sweet grapes and aromatic curry add exciting new flavors to traditional chicken salad. Serve on croissants or over greens.

10. Caprese Pasta Salad

Bring this simple Italian salad to life with pasta. Toss together mozzarella, tomatoes, basil, cooked pasta, olive oil, and balsamic vinegar. The pasta soaks up the delicious dressing and turns this into a hearty meal. Rotini or farfalle work nicely for grabbing the tomatoes and cheese.

11. Mexican Street Corn Salad

Capture the flavors of popular Mexican street corn in a salad. Mix charred corn, cotija cheese, cilantro, lime juice, and chili powder. For extra creaminess, add mayo or Mexican crema. Top with crunchy pepitas for texture. This salad is spicy, sweet, and tangy.

12. Spinach Salad with Berries and Goat Cheese

Sweet, juicy berries complement the tangy goat cheese in this colorful salad. Toss baby spinach with raspberries, blueberries, strawberries, crumbled goat cheese, walnuts, and poppyseed dressing. The variety of textures and flavors makes this salad shine.

13. Kale and Quinoa Tabbouleh

For a nutrition boost, use kale instead of parsley in tabbouleh. Toss quinoa with chopped kale, tomatoes, cucumber, mint, and lemon vinaigrette. The quinoa adds protein, while kale gives a mega dose of vitamins. This fresh twist adds both nutrients and crunch.

14. Fried Chicken Salad with Ranch

Crispy, fried chicken tenders transform this salad into a meal. Toss fried chicken with mixed greens, cherry tomatoes, shredded cheese, bacon bits, and ranch dressing. The hot chicken contrasts the cool lettuce and cheese for the ultimate, savory salad.

15. Summer Harvest Salad with Grilled Halloumi

Grilled halloumi cheese adds a smoky, meaty element to this seasonal salad. Toss grilled halloumi, summer veggies like zucchini, bell peppers, corn, fresh herbs, and lemon vinaigrette. The halloumi provides a satisfying heft and texture contrast to the produce.
